1976 Gottlieb’s “Bank Shot”  rare add a ball version of the super popular “Sure Shot” as it only was made for New York and Wisconsin the two states that outlawed winning free games.  Gottlieb only made 730 “Bank Shot’s” and made 3700 “Sure Shot’s”.  Freshly restored May 2010 and ready for your gameroom the only pool themed machine pinrescue has in stock ready to ship. Some of the  greatest Gottlieb machines were single player billiard themed machines like 1950 Bank a Ball, 1952 Skill Pool, 1958 Roto Pool, 1962 Rack a Ball, 1965  Bank a Ball ( so good they did a remake 15 years later) 1969 Target Pool culminating in this 1976 Bank Shot . It was the last of it's kind  never to be the same after 1977 when pinball went digital and the sounds and feel of pinball changed forever. Engaging features found on this nice dependable "Sure Shot":

  • Minimum of Five balls per game to "make" all 15 pool balls.
  • Make all the balls and three different WOW’s light for the rest of the ball
  • Making all the pool balls resets for next ball with fewer to make to relight the WOW’s
  • Two kicker holes whose scoring varies from 500 to 5,000 depending on which pool balls are made.
  • Rebuilt Chime box which plays 20 different tunes on the kicker hole scoring depending on which pool balls are made.
  • Three rebuilt pop bumpers they are strong and snappy.
  • Countdown bonus after each ball is drained 1,000 points for each ball made.
  • 100,000 scoring for over the top fun.
